Transaction 100571b3bc8c80c103546fd07deea73db7a5d1a1f81084435d6ea7c764519d94

3 Input
2 Outputs
  • 100571b3bc8c80c103546fd07deea73db7a5d1a1f81084435d6ea7c764519d94:0
  • value  3668500
    address  121yhQLCFiig8ab3ofBCNBsxMJ2wfuz3Z5
  • 100571b3bc8c80c103546fd07deea73db7a5d1a1f81084435d6ea7c764519d94:1
  • value  1169389
    address  1HhdreNnNNsPUFYWGWYHyGoj4j5Y8GLJ9p